Eagles to Offer Randy Moss HUGE Deal

Over the weekend I heard ESPN’s Chris Mortenson reported that if Randy Moss hits free agency, he will be offered a $40 million deal on the first day from the Eagles.

Also over the weekend it seems that there are a lot of teams who have reportedly shown interest in Donovan McNabb. Their is a rumor that the Dolphins reportedly would offer the #1 pick for him which I think has to be wrong, but very interesting and if I were the Eagles I might consider.  We all have heard that the Bears are interested (Donnie returning home to Chi-town), as well as Brad Childress and Minnesota, and Jon Harbaugh and the Ravens.
